Key Responsibilities
Field Leadership & Project Execution
- Oversee day-to-day electrical construction activities on large-scale commercial and industrial projects.
- Lead field crews, subcontractors, and foremen to ensure work is completed safely, efficiently, and in accordance with project schedules.
- Coordinate manpower planning, material deliveries, and equipment requirements to maintain project progress.
- Drive productivity while maintaining high standards of workmanship and safety compliance.
Project Coordination
- Collaborate closely with project managers, general contractors, engineers, and clients throughout all phases of construction.
- Participate in project meetings and provide regular updates on schedule, manpower, and field progress.
- Coordinate installation sequencing with other trades to avoid conflicts and delays.
- Assist with constructability reviews and proactively identify potential project issues.
Safety & Quality Control
- Enforce OSHA standards and company safety procedures across all job sites.
- Conduct regular safety meetings, site inspections, and quality control checks.
- Ensure all installations meet project specifications, code requirements, and client expectations.
- Maintain accurate field documentation, daily reports, and progress tracking.
Scheduling & Workforce Management
- Support and manage project schedules to ensure milestones and deadlines are achieved.
- Supervise and mentor field personnel, ensuring effective communication and accountability.
- Coordinate with procurement teams to ensure timely delivery of materials and equipment.
- Assist in resolving field-related issues and managing project changes efficiently.
